The Apartment Water Extraction Process Explained
When you call us for Apartment Water Extraction, you can expect our team to follow a proven process that ensures your property is restored to its original condition. Our process involves identifying the source of the water, extracting the water, and drying the affected area. We’ll work quickly and efficiently to reduce downtime and prevent further damage.
Identify the Source of the Water
We’ll assess your apartment to find out the source of the water damage, whether it’s due to a leaky pipe, a burst appliance, or something else entirely. Our team will use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ture and identify the entry point of the water.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ring a thorough cleanup.
Extract the Water
Using industrial-grade equipment, our technicians will extract as much water as possible from the affected area. We’ll use truck-mounted extractors, submersible pumps, and other specialized tools to remove water from walls, floors, and ceilings. Our goal is to remove as much water as possible to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old growth.
Dry the Affected Area
Once the water has been extracted, our team will use specialized equipment to dry the affected area. We’ll use desiccants, dehumidifiers, and air movers to remove excess moisture from the air and speed up the drying process.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and ensuring your apartment is safe to inhabit.
Monitor and Clean
After the drying process is complete, our team will monitor the affected area to ensure it’s completely dry. We’ll also clean and disinfect the area to remove any remaining debris and contaminants. This step is crucial in ensuring your apartment is safe and healthy to inhabit.
